This week is the 50th anniversary of the launch of Mercury Sigma 7 capsule with astronaut Wally Schirra on October 3, 1962.
http://www.nasa.gov/mission_pages/mercury/missions/sigma7.html

Sigma 7 featured the first Hasselblad camera and photography from earth orbit.  
The camera was purchased at a Houston photo shop.

50 years of technology later, beautiful photographs were released today by NASA from ISS.

The photos are of small satellites released outside the ISS Kibo laboratory using a Small Satellite Orbital Deployer attached to the Japanese module's robotic arm. 
Japan Aerospace Exploration Agency astronaut Aki Hoshide, flight engineer, set up the satellite deployment gear inside the lab and placed it in the Kibo airlock for deployment.
